Carolyn Ruth Lehman, 65, of Lowell, Ohio, passed away surrounded by her family Friday, November 29, 2019 at Camden Clark Medical Center in Parkersburg, WV. She was born on November 18, 1954 in Carlisle, PA to Alvey Jacob and Velma Ruth Kopp Keefer, Jr.
Carolyn graduated from Boiling Springs High School in 1972 and received her Bachelor of Science in Business Administration from Ashland University in 1995. After working for Ashland University for 11 years and Coldwater Creek for 10 years, she retired from the Bureau of Fiscal Services in 2012. Carolyn was a member of Marietta First Church of the Nazarene in Marietta, Ohio, where she was involved with the Praise and Worship Team. She enjoyed reading, cooking, entertaining, and most importantly spending time with her children, grandchildren and family.
She is survived by her husband, Dennis Lehman, whom she married on April 13, 1973, her mother of Carlisle, PA; four children, Christopher Lehman (Jill) of Joffre, PA, Heidi Mayer of Chicago, IL, Jesse Lehman of Marietta, and Rebekah Framan (Joe) of Cleveland, OH; eight grandchildren, Taylor, Zachary, Zoee, Turner, Evelyn, Riley, Erica and Melvyn; one great grandson, Kasen; siblings, Sandra Myers (Dale) of Carlisle, Diana Moses (Stewart) of Nashville, TN and David Keefer of Carlisle; sister in law, Nancy Keefer of Mechanicsburg, PA; and many nieces and nephews.
She was preceded in death by her father; granddaughter, Emma; brother, Ronald Keefer; and infant sister, Wanda Sue.
